What is the consequence of failing to renew a salesperson license on time?

Failing to renew a salesperson license on time can result in penalties or the requirement to retake the licensing exam. This is particularly important as it underscores the regulatory framework surrounding the issuance and maintenance of salesperson licenses. In many states, including Wisconsin, maintaining licensure is essential for legal compliance and continued employment in vehicle sales.

If the license is not renewed within the designated period, the salesperson may face fines or other administrative penalties that could hinder their ability to operate effectively. Additionally, they may be required to demonstrate their qualifications again, which can include retaking the licensing exam to ensure they are up-to-date with the current laws and best practices within the auto sales industry. Keeping a license current is thus vital not just for personal compliance but also for protecting the integrity of the sales profession as a whole.
